Jetset Report: American Eagle Adds First Class

February 25, 2010 By: Meagan Drillinger
 


Starting July 2 airline customers can look forward to a new First Class service aboard American Eagle Airlines' CRJ-700 jets.

The nine-seat First Class sections will offer complimentary dining services that include breakfast and lunch on longer flights, and a gourmet snack on short-haul flights.

The First Class service will be offered from American Eagle's Chicago and Dallas/Forth Worth hubs. From Chicago customers can fly First Class to Atlanta, Washington, D.C., Newark, Houston, Oklahoma City, Minneapolis, Philadelphia, San Antonio and Salt Lake City. From dallas/Fort Worth First Class is available to Cleveland, Milwaukee, Bentonville/Springdale, Arkansas and Little Rock, Arkansas.
